Father of Russian human rights. Alexander Yesenin-Volpin-90
Today, 90 years old, Alexander Sergeyevich Yesenin-Volpin, is 90 years old, to a person who can be rightfully called the founding father of the human rights movement in the USSR. It was he who in the early 60s insisted-and insisted-that the struggle against Soviet totalitarianism and lawlessness should be conducted exclusively by peaceful legal means. “(Violence) rests on emotions and feelings,” said Yesenin-Wolpin.
